Output 5896f80183dabf0442d827e5603ec91b6610e39b8b531b1a194ccc6d3e7be1cf:8

value
34227039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d1a378b3bf14cc729926029774e01f1dd4c14e1 OP_EQUAL
address
MC1e3eczsAzPa3TLMFZ4i3LYYHLZy1QqcN
transaction
5896f80183dabf0442d827e5603ec91b6610e39b8b531b1a194ccc6d3e7be1cf
spent
true